Summer’s the perfect time to stop rats before they take over your garden—when young rats are scouting for food like fruit, birdseed, or your prized plants. Planting strong-smelling herbs like peppermint, lavender, rosemary, and basil creates a natural, fragrant barrier that deters them with their sensitive noses. These herbs also mask food smells, pushing rats away before they settle in. Peppermint’s menthol punch is especially effective—just keep it potted to control its spread.
